History has been made on your birthday. The following are important historical events that occurred on August 26
| Year | Event |
|---|---|
| 1966 | The South African Border War starts with the battle at Omugulugwombashe. |
| 1970 | The fiftieth anniversary of American women being able to vote is marked by a nationwide Women's Strike for Equality. |
| 1972 | The Games of the XX Olympiad open in Munich, West Germany. |
| 1977 | The Charter of the French Language is adopted by the National Assembly of Quebec. |
| 1978 | Papal conclave: Albino Luciani is elected as Pope John Paul I. |
| 1980 | After John Birges plants a bomb at Harvey's Resort Hotel in Stateline, Nevada, in the United States, the FBI inadvertently detonates the bomb during its disarming. |
| 1997 | Beni Ali massacre occurs in Algeria, leaving 60 to 100 people dead. |
| 1998 | The first flight of the Boeing Delta III ends in disaster 75 seconds after liftoff resulting in the loss of the Galaxy X communications satellite. |
| 1999 | Russia begins the Second Chechen War in response to the Invasion of Dagestan by the Islamic International Peacekeeping Brigade. |
| 2003 | A Beechcraft 1900 operating as Colgan Air Flight 9446 crashes after taking off from Barnstable Municipal Airport in Yarmouth, Massachusetts, killing both pilots on board. |
In 1926,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, Robert is the most used. A total of 61,130 baby boys were named Robert in 1926. The rest were named John, James, William and Charles. While the popular baby girl name in 1926 was Mary. There were 67,836 baby girls named Mary that year. While the rest were named Dorothy, Betty, Helen and Margaret.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
